Special offers and Exclusive deals

Search Hotels

2025-06-12
2025-06-13
Guests

Filter Results

Hotels by class

Hotel name

Price per night

Accommodation type

Districts

Attractions

Thematic hotels

Review rating

Hotel facilities

Room facilities

Apply Filters
Clear Filters

Casino hotels in British Columbia

Delta Hotels By Marriott Grand Okanagan Resort

1310 Water Street, Kelowna, Canada View map

Immerse yourself in a lakeside ambiance at Delta Hotels by Marriott Grand Okanagan Resort, situated in the heart of British Columbia's Wine Country. This resort is located in Downtown Kelowna, just a… More

From US$ 360 Book Now

Delta Hotels By Marriott Burnaby Conference Centre

4331 Dominion Street, Burnaby, Canada View map

The Delta Hotels by Marriott Burnaby Conference Centre is a haven in a scenic travel destination with panoramic water views. This beautifully designed hotel offers a location in the heart of Burnaby,… More

From US$ 115 Book Now

St. Eugene Golf Resort & Casino

7777 Mission Road, Cranbrook, Canada View map

The St Eugene Golf Resort & Casino Cranbrook is a full-service resort nestled in the beautiful East Kootenays. The property boasts an on-site mountain golf course featuring incredible views of the St… More

From US$ 96 Book Now

River Rock Casino Hotel

8811 River Road, Richmond, Canada View map

The wonderful River Rock Casino Hotel Richmond, located nearly a 5-minute drive from Iona Beach Regional Park, is proud to offer 5 restaurants. Guests will enjoy an indoor swimming pool while staying… More

From US$ 179 Book Now

Prestige Treasure Cove Resort, Worldhotels Elite

2005 Highway 97 S, Prince George, Canada View map

The comfortable 4-star Prestige Treasure Cove Resort, Worldhotels Elite Prince George, located 3.4 km from Purden Lake Provincial Park, offers an indoor swimming pool and Wi-Fi in public areas. The… More

From US$ 88 Book Now

The Douglas, Autograph Collection

45 Smithe Street, Vancouver, Canada View map

The Douglas, Autograph Collection Hotel Vancouver is a modernist enclave nestled in downtown Vancouver's vibrant neighborhood. This desirable waterside location next to False Creek creates a balanced… More

From US$ 211 Book Now

Courtyard By Marriott Nanaimo

100 Gordon Street, Nanaimo, Canada View map

Courtyard By Marriott Nanaimo Hotel is around 25 minutes on foot from Harewood Centennial Park Playground and has an indoor swimming pool plus a fitness room. Located a walk from Harbourfront Walkway… More

From US$ 151 Book Now

Coast Langley City Hotel & Convention Centre

20393 Fraser Highway, Langley, Canada View map

Offering a comfortable location 10 minutes' drive from Milner Valley Cheese, Coast Hotel & Convention Centre Langley is proud to feature 2 restaurants. This hotel features both Wi-Fi in public areas… More

From US$ 100 Book Now

Fairfield Inn & Suites By Marriott Vernon

5300 Anderson Way, Vernon, Canada View map

Offering a lobby area, the 3-star Fairfield Inn & Suites By Marriott Vernon lies in a business district, approximately 10 minutes' drive from Vernon Public Art Gallery and a 10-minute ride from… More

From US$ 89 Book Now

Best Western Maple Ridge

21650 Lougheed Highway, Maple Ridge, Canada View map

Situated 2.8 km from Derby Reach Regional Park, the 3-star Best Western Maple Ridge Hotel features Wi-Fi in public areas, and a car park on site. Guests can take a walk along the river, 30 metres… More

From US$ 79 Book Now

Pomeroy Hotel Fort St. John

11308 Alaska Road, Fort St. John, Canada View map

The contemporary 4-star Pomeroy Hotel Fort St. John is located in a business area and offers an indoor swimming pool and a fitness studio. Featuring a restaurant, the smoke-free hotel is merely 1.8… More

From US$ 104 Book Now

Billy Barker Casino Hotel

308 Mclean St., Quesnel, Canada View map

Situated 18 minutes' stroll from Dragon Lake, the 4-star Billy Barker Casino Hotel Quesnel features wedding services and a casino. Highlights at this Quesnel hotel include an ATM machine and a lift… More

From US$ 74 Book Now

Stonebridge Hotel Dawson Creek

500 Highway 2, Dawson Creek, Canada View map

The 4-star Stonebridge Hotel Dawson Creek, located near the business district of Dawson Creek, features a 24-hour front desk, late check-out, and wake-up service as well as Wi-Fi in public areas. More

From US$ 86 Book Now

Surestay Plus Hotel By Best Western Salmon Arm

61 10Th Street Sw, Salmon Arm, Canada View map

Located 10 minutes by car from R.J. Haney Heritage Village and Museum in Salmon Arm, the delightful 3-star Surestay Plus Hotel By Best Western Salmon Arm offers a spa lounge including a Jacuzzi and… More

From US$ 100 Book Now

Prestige Oceanview Hotel Prince Rupert

118 6Th Street, Prince Rupert, Canada View map

Featuring a vending machine and complimentary newspapers, the 3-star Prestige Oceanview Hotel Prince Rupert is located close to a business district and approximately a 15-minute walk from The Prince… More

From US$ 131 Book Now

Vacation Internationale Royal Victoria Suites

1413 Government St., Victoria, Canada View map

Situated 1.2 km from a rejuvenating destination like Crystal Pool Recreation Center, the 3-star Vacation Internationale Royal Victoria Suites hotel provides a wellness centre. More

Book Now

Cycle Inn Bed And Breakfast

3158 Anders, Langford, Canada View map

Located merely 200 metres from Glen Lake Farm Market, Cycle Inn Bed And Breakfast Langford includes a swimming pool and a sun terrace. The inn boasts views of the lake and offers Wi-Fi throughout the… More

From US$ 132 Book Now

Rest Inn

4326 Lakelse Ave, Terrace, Canada View map

Featuring views of the city, the 3-star Rest Inn Terrace is located at a 2.4 km distance from Heritage Park Museum. Wi Fi is accessible throughout the property and private parking is provided on site. More

From US$ 28 Book Now

Travelodge By Wyndham Abbotsford Bakerview

1821 Sumas Way, Abbotsford, Canada View map

The affordable Travelodge By Wyndham Abbotsford Bakerview hotel is located 15 km from Abbotsford airport and offers an indoor pool as well as a sports complex. The 3-star midscale inn is situated in… More

From US$ 74 Book Now

Caravan Motel

9711 Alaska Road, Fort St. John, Canada View map

Located 10 minutes by car from Church Of The Resurrection, the 2-star Caravan Motel Fort St. John includes 24 rooms. Wi-Fi is offered in public areas and a car park is available on site. More

From US$ 51 Book Now

White House Bed And Breakfast

445 East 49Th Avenue, Vancouver, Canada View map

Situated about 10 minutes by car from Vancouver City Hall, the 2-star White House Bed And Breakfast Vancouver features Wi-Fi in the rooms and a car park nearby. This budget hotel is a good starting… More

From US$ 132 Book Now

Ocean Marina Hotel

4850 Beaver Creek Rd, Port Alberni, Canada View map

Featuring Wi-Fi in public areas, Ocean Marina Hotel Port Alberni sits 1.4 km from MacMillan Provincial Park. At the hotel, guests will find a ice rink to stay active. More

From US$ 62 Book Now

Luxury Penthouse Downtown Nanaimo

503 Comox Road, Nanaimo, Canada View map

The spacious 279 m² Luxury Penthouse Downtown Nanaimo Apartment includes a terrace and is situated around a 5-minute ride from Port Theatre. The scenic Colliery Dam Park is at a medium distance from… More

From US$ 486 Book Now

Condo In Downtown Vancouver - Near Rogers Arena

58 Keefer Place 2502, Vancouver, Canada View map

The spacious 70 m² Condo In Downtown Vancouver - Near Rogers Arena is located only 1.4 km from FlyOver Canada and offers spa facilities such as a hot tub and an indoor pool. Queen Elizabeth Theatre… More

From US$ 296 Book Now

Salishan Tree House Suite

996 Khenipsen Road, Cowichan Bay, Canada View map

Salishan Tree House Suite is situated in Cowichan Bay, around 15 minutes by car from Hand of Man Natural History Museum and 2.7 km from Cowichan Bay Maritime Centre. The villa comprises 2 bedrooms… More

From US$ 632 Book Now

Luxury Condo With Jacuzzi Pool & Sauna In Prime Location

Keefer Place 58, Vancouver, Canada View map

The spacious 2-bedroom Luxury Condo With Jacuzzi Pool & Sauna In Prime Location Vancouver is just 6 minutes on foot from Cathedral of Our Lady of the Holy Rosary and includes a fitness studio. This… More

From US$ 334 Book Now

Luxury Apartment Jacuzzi Pool & Sauna In Prime Location

Keefer Place 188, Vancouver, Canada View map

Situated in proximity to Stadium-Chinatown underground station, the spacious 79 m² Luxury Apartment Jacuzzi Pool & Sauna In Prime Location Vancouver offers Wi-Fi for business or leisure needs. The 2… More

From US$ 325 Book Now

Canadas Best Value Inn Langley/Vancouver

6722 Glover Road, Langley, Canada View map

The 3-star Canadas Best Value Inn Langley/Vancouver is located 7 km from Langley Centennial Museum & Exhibition Centre, offering 46 rooms along with a casino and a sauna. Staying at the budget inn… More

From US$ 64 Book Now

Dockside Getaways Inc

8031 River Road, Richmond, Canada View map

If you are in love with sports, Dockside Getaways Inc Hotel Richmond has a great location as it is set nearly 25 minutes' walk from Richmond Olympic Oval Sports Arena; also Fraser River Waterfront… More

Book Now

Destinations At Holiday Park

1 415 Commonwealth Road, Winfield, Canada View map

The 3-star Destinations At Holiday Park Winfield can arrange horse riding tours for active guests, while lying about a 10-minute ride from Beasley Park. The hotel is a good starting point for… More

Book Now

Best Bed And Breakfast

2679 1St Avenue, Port Alberni, Canada View map

Located not too far from Port Alberni Maritime Discovery Centre, Best Bed And Breakfast Port Alberni features a patio with outdoor dining areas and a barbeque grill. The recently renovated bed &… More

From US$ 176 Book Now

Upscale Modern Apartment

4340 Lorimer Road #346, Whistler, Canada View map

The spacious 1-bedroom Upscale Modern Apartment Whistler is located right in the centre of Whistler and offers quick access to Whistler's Marketplace, which is 300 metres away. In this 60 m²… More

From US$ 311 Book Now

Beach Lake Resort

3699 Capozzi Road 708, Kelowna, Canada View map

The beachfront Beach Lake View Resort Kelowna is situated 3.7 km from The View Winery and Vineyard and offers a fitness studio. Wi-Fi and a free private car park are among the essentials at guests'… More

Book Now

Lily House

5900 Francis Road, Richmond, Canada View map

Lily House Hotel Richmond is located 4 km from the history museum "London Heritage Farm Tea Room" and 10 minutes by car from Steveston Museum. More

From US$ 46 Book Now

2 Bedroom Apartment With Sauna & Pool Next To Mall

188 Keefer Place, Vancouver, Canada View map

The spacious 77 m² 2 Bedroom Apartment With Sauna & Pool Next To Mall Vancouver lies merely 1.4 km from Canada Place and really close to Stadium-Chinatown tube station. Active guests might as well… More

From US$ 129 Book Now

Spacious Modern High-Rise With Ocean & City Views

128 West Cordova Street, Vancouver, Canada View map

Located in the immediate vicinity of Stadium-Chinatown underground station, the 2-room Spacious Modern High-Rise With Ocean & City Views Apartment Vancouver offers currency exchange and a lift. More

Book Now

The Vida 1 Bed Pet-Friendly

34878 Millar Crescent, Abbotsford, Bc V2S 7K5, Abbotsford, Canada View map

More

Book Now

One-Of-A-Kind Luxury 3 Bed Penthouse W/ Huge Private Patio, Hot Tub & Firetable!

633 Abbott Street 806, Vancouver, Canada View map

More

Book Now

Edge Of The Mountain Villa

2705 Edgemont Blvd, North Vancouver, Canada View map

More

Book Now